from what ive read it doesnt work for everyone and builds a tolerance rather fast, but it seems to be great in combination with alcohol of benzo's
 
Other than tolerance, the only problem I've read about Phenibut is that it can be pretty much as addictive as GBL with very nasty withdrawls that can last for up to 2 weeks. This is only an issue if you take it daily, though the fact that it is sold as a 'nootropic' is likely to encourage people to do this (just like with piracetam, only that doesn't really have withdrawl effects so it's not a problem).

GABA does not cross the the blood brain barrier. It's a waste of time taking it.
 
Really, cause it works real nice for me, definitly not placebo..

I've been thinking, is crossing this blood-brain barrier really all that important, anyway?
 
I can attest that GABA does in fact have psychoactive effects, even when taken alone. I think this importance of crossing the BBB is overstated, ephedrine barely croses it, and is a potent stimulant. Loperamide does not cross it at all, and can cause drowsiness in opiate naive-tolerant people. I have personally found 1-3 grams of powdered GABA to be quite relaxing, and 5-6 grams to be intensely sedating.
